【Discussion】
Mesenteric panniculitis is reported to occur in teens to eighties with symptoms of abdominal pain, abdominal mass, fever or ileus-like symptoms of vomiting and abdominal fullness (1, 2). The onset location includes small-intestine mesentery, transverse-colon mesentery and sigmoid colon mesentery (1). In these days, a specimen of mesenteric panniculitis is documented to contain IgG4 component (3). However, it is controversial whether the mesentery panniculitis is relevant with IG4-related disease. Eighty percent of the reported cases in Japan underwent laparotomy for the purpose of digestive duct resection, artificial anal creation or biopsy (1). Twenty percent of those in Japan and most oversea cases underwent conservative treatments of antibiotics, low dose steroid or immune-suppressive agents (2, 4, 5,6).

【Summary】
A fourteen-year-old male came to our hospital for further investigation of abdominal mass detected by ultrasound. Non-enhanced CT and enhanced CT depicted densification of fat of the small-intestine-mesentery with preservation of the mesenteric vessels and with the fat halo sign (4-5) and the tumorous pseudocapsule sign (4-6). An image of diffusion MRI depicted a decrease of signal intensity of the lesion with the increase of b-values. The medical practitioner should recognize this rare disease with specific signs on abdominal CT since the surgical treatment can be avoidable.
